Most of the time there will be an improvement with an aftermarket performance exhaust on any car:

1. Sound may be better or just loud.
2. A freer flow. Stock exhausts are normally tight due to noise and emission restrictions.
3. The power increase may be minimal or zero if it is only the rear muffler thats been replaced. Bigger gains are in decatting the exhaust.
4. Best results is full freeflow and decatted exhaust WITH a tune/chip/remap.
